Size-controlled synthesis of cobalt-ferrite nanoparticles, their passivation and peptization as stable ferrofluids are reported. Transmission electron microscopy and Mossbauer spectroscopy were used as characterization techniques. Particles with little change in size distribution, in the 10-15nm diameter ranges, were obtained using stirring speeds between 2700 and 8100 rpm. The anomalous diffusion has been used to explain the nanoparticle size-control mechanism. (C) 2001 Elsevier Science B.V. All rights reserved.
